| I am going to get a kicker motor for trolling and I was thinking either a 9.9 or a 6 hp Mercury 4 stroke.Will the 6 hp be enough motor for pushing my Tuffy esox Mag 4 miles an hour? Thanks,Paul | |
| | |
| Paul, I fish from a ranger620vs thats a big heavy boat,there is a 9,9four stroke on the back and there has not been a time when I needed more speed. Dont know the exact top end of my 9.9 but there has always been lots of room left. Have tried to troll at higher speeds on my pond,none higher than 5mph. This year will try faster. I think a 6 will do you fine. | |

| Paul:
I'd go with a 9.9 2 stroke because of the weight, over the 4 stroke, probably not too much differance in price if you are looking at used. If you are going too fast you can always twist the throttle towards slow. Then if the big motor fails for some reason you can still get home at a decent rate (been there, done that).
The 9.9 mercs are time proven, and a great motor. More power is always better.
